Cheetah Mobile (CMCM) Tops Q4 EPS by 6c
Cheetah Mobile (NYSE: CMCM) reported Q4 EPS of $0.12, $0.06 better than the analyst estimate of $0.06. Revenue for the quarter came in at $183.6 million versus the consensus estimate of $177.31 million.
- Total revenues increased by 10.9% year over year and 13.0% quarter over quarter to RMB1,274.7 million (US$183.6 million).
- Mobile revenues increased by 27.9% year over year and 15.0% quarter over quarter to RMB1,033.3 million (US$148.8 million). Mobile revenues accounted for 81.1% of total revenues.
- Overseas revenues[1] increased by 31.3% year over year and 15.7% quarter over quarter to RMB832.6 million (US$119.9 million). Overseas revenues accounted for 65.3% of total revenues.
- Net income attributable to Cheetah Mobile shareholders was RMB58.8 million (US$8.5 million). Non-GAAP net income attributable to Cheetah Mobile shareholders was RMB113.0 million (US$16.3 million).
- Net cash generated by operating activities was RMB433.2 million (US$62.4 million).
For the first quarter of 2017, the Company expects its total revenues to be between RMB1,150 million (US$166 million) and RMB1,190 million (US$171 million), representing a year-over-year increase of 3% to 7% and quarter-over-quarter decrease of 7% to 10%. This estimate represents management\'s preliminary view as of the date of this release, which is subject to change.
